Myth 1: AI is Only for Large Corporations

One prevalent myth is that AI is exclusively beneficial for large corporations with hefty budgets. In reality, AI tools are becoming increasingly accessible and affordable for businesses of all sizes. Many AI solutions are available as Software as a Service (SaaS), which means small businesses can subscribe and scale their usage based on needs without substantial upfront investment.

Myth 2: Implementing AI is Too Complex

Another common belief is that adopting AI requires intricate technical knowledge. While it’s true that AI can be complex, many solutions are designed with user-friendliness in mind. Small businesses can take advantage of intuitive platforms that require no coding skills, making it easier to integrate AI into daily operations.

The Reality of AI in Small Business

AI can transform how small businesses operate by automating routine tasks, improving customer service, and providing data-driven insights. By leveraging AI, small businesses can compete more effectively, even against larger competitors.

AI for Customer Engagement

AI-powered chatbots and virtual assistants enhance customer engagement by providing real-time support and personalized experiences. These tools are cost-effective and can operate 24/7, which is crucial for maintaining customer satisfaction and loyalty.

Enhancing Decision-Making with AI

Data analysis is another area where AI shines. Small businesses generate vast amounts of data that can be overwhelming to analyze manually. AI algorithms can sift through this data quickly, uncovering trends and insights that inform smarter business decisions.

Taking the First Step Towards AI Adoption

To begin leveraging AI, small businesses should start by identifying areas where they could benefit most—whether it’s automating repetitive tasks or enhancing customer interactions. From there, exploring scalable AI solutions that fit their needs and budget is key.
